Grammar usage guide and real-world examples

US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"after this implementation"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to refer to a point in time or a sequence of events that occurs following the completion of an implementation process. Example: "After this implementation, we will begin testing the new features to ensure they function as intended."

FAQs

How can I use "after this implementation" in a sentence?

You can use "after this implementation" to indicate the timing or consequences of a process being put into effect. For instance, "After this implementation, we expect to see significant improvements in efficiency."

What phrases are similar to "after this implementation"?

Similar phrases include "following this implementation", "subsequent to this implementation", or "post-implementation" depending on the desired level of formality.

Is it better to say "after the implementation" or "after this implementation"?

The choice depends on the context. "After the implementation" is more general, while "after this implementation" refers to a specific implementation already mentioned or understood. If you've previously discussed a particular implementation, use "after this implementation". Otherwise, "after the implementation" might be more appropriate.

What is the difference between "before this implementation" and "after this implementation"?

"Before this implementation" refers to the period preceding a specific implementation, while "after this implementation" refers to the period following it. They are used to compare conditions or results before and after a change.
